While the menu is more selective I found everything to be far better in taste and how it is cooked! Today we shared the Mediterranean appetizer with hummus and tzatziki. Hummus is smooth and have a tahini forward flavor. My spouse and I both liked it. Tzatziki is exceptional. It is one of my favorite sauces in the world and this is great. Pita was a wonderful texture and taste wise. I ordered the chicken plate. It came out sizzling hot like fajitas traditionally do. The chicken was temperature right out of the oven, juicy and an excellent texture. Couscous on the side was beautifully cooked and had a nice touch of spice to it. The other metal bowl on my platter had a greek village style salad with diced cucumbers, diced red onions and cut in half mini tomatoes. Spouse had a Turkish pizza. The seasoning had a nice spice and kick to it. He enjoyed his meal. Spouse ordered 2 beers on draft. One of the beers was one he had before not on draft and was thrilled to try it on draft as he liked it way more. He was happy with their beer on draft selection. When deciding whether to choose the birthday or neapolitan cake we asked the gentleman at the register which he thought was better or more special. He recommended Neapolitan. It was absolutely perfect and delicious! I have never had a cake quite like it. Would totally choose it again! Very happy with the food, quality, temperature, texture and juiciness. All far surpasses it previously. Will return very soon. FYI they can only take cash tips so bring some cash. They do not take credit card, nor do they have a QR code for Venmo, PayPal, Cash App or Zelle.

Tacos are lightly seasoned and topped with pico and avacado, onions and lime on the side. Chicken is cooked through but still soft and moist. Same for the steak but with some crispy edges. Grilled onions and lime squeezings make for a fine dinner. Yay! I'm a fan!

    I was researching taco trucks and bookmarked this place in hopes of giving it a try…read more The truck sits outside the store. The menu has a few item types with a large variety of meat choices, or vegetables. There is also a special of three tacos with rice and beans for $7, which is what I got. The food was prepared to order and took about five minutes. The tacos were overstuffed (that's a good thing) with meat and onions. The green salsa was excellent and not too spicy and next time I will try the next spice level up. Oh yeah, the beans are fantastic...but the tacos are definitely the stand out here.

    Tuesday Taco Night Perfection!…read more Tacos and Beer Paola in Lexington is such a gem. This unique spot sits next to its sister location--an older Stop & Go that's packed with Mexican boots, treats, sodas, and food goods--which already sets the vibe before you even walk in. We stopped in for Tuesday taco night and were immediately impressed. Chips and salsa came out with two fantastic salsas, both full of flavor. There's also a Pepsi cooler stocked with Mexican sodas and beers, which was a fun and authentic touch. The staff was beyond friendly--welcoming, patient, and genuinely happy to have us there. Now the tacos... wow. Finger-licking good. I devoured three tacos: brisket, steak, sausage, and cow head--every single one was incredible. The cheese dip was smooth, rich, and absolutely wonderful. My husband loved his chicken and steak tacos as well. If I had to give one tip: do not skip the roasted jalapeños. Trust me. We'll definitely be back soon--and next time, we're bringing the kiddos.

    Always a great experience. This gem is only about 15 minutes from my house and has become a staple…read morefor us. We discovered it several months ago on a whim (just happened to catch our eye on a drive). We've been many times and have tried several different options. Portions are very generous and the flavor is amazing. My personal favorite is the Tacos al Pastor. The staff is always friendly and cheerful. They also have to-go available, which we have done as well. Highly recommend.

    I had Bartaco in Birkdale for the first time over the weekend. The set up was cute and there's…read moreplenty of tables. We were seated quickly without a reservation. We had guacamole & chips for an appetizer - this was fine but nothing special. The chips are tostada style so you may need to ask for extra if sharing with a group. For lunch, I got the pork belly and chicken verde tacos. The menu advises 3 bites per taco which is pretty accurate. We ordered street corn & plantains for sides, both were quite good. I got churros for dessert and they were probably the highlight of the meal.
